Description

tert-Butyl 1,1,3,3-Tetramethylbutyl Peroxide is a high-purity organic peroxide primarily valued as a free radical initiator and cross-linking agent. Its controlled decomposition characteristics make it essential for initiating polymerization reactions and modifying polymer properties. This compound is critical for manufacturers in the polymer and specialty chemical industries seeking reliable, high-performance initiators for production.

Application

  • Polymerization Initiator: Used as a free radical source for the production of polymers like polyethylene (LDPE), polystyrene, and acrylics.
  • Cross-Linking Agent: Facilitates the cross-linking of elastomers and polyolefins to enhance thermal and mechanical properties.
  • Organic Synthesis Intermediate: Serves as a reagent in the synthesis of specialty chemicals and pharmaceutical intermediates.
  • Curing Agent for Resins: Employed in the curing processes of unsaturated polyester resins and other thermosetting polymers.
  • Modifier for Polymer Properties: Used to control molecular weight and branching during polymer manufacturing.

Basic Information

Product Name tert-Butyl 1,1,3,3-Tetramethylbutyl Peroxide
CAS No. 85153-88-4
Molecular Formula C12H26O2
Molecular Weight 202.34 g/mol
Synonyms 1,1,3,3-Tetramethylbutyl tert-butyl peroxide; tert-Butyl 2,2,4,4-tetramethylpentyl peroxide; 2,2,4,4-Tetramethylpentyl tert-butyl peroxide; TBTP; Peroxide, tert-butyl 1,1,3,3-tetramethylbutyl; tert-Butyl(1,1,3,3-tetramethylbutyl)peroxide; (2,2,4,4-Tetramethylpentyl)oxy-tert-butane

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, well-ventilated area away from heat, sparks, and open flames. Keep container tightly sealed and separate from incompatible materials such as reducing agents, strong acids, and bases. Recommended storage temperature is 15-25°C. Due to its nature as a strong oxidizer, handle and store with appropriate precautions to prevent decomposition.
